MMP16 also known as MT3-MMP (membrane-type 3 matrix metalloproteinase) is an enzyme part of the matrix metalloproteinase family. It plays a mechanical role in the degradation of extracellular matrix components. MMP16 has a molecular mass of 66 kDa and has proteolytic activity that contributes to tissue remodeling processes. This protein is a membrane-bound enzyme expressed in several tissues including the brain lungs and placenta. In the central nervous system it aids in maintaining extracellular environment by breaking down proteins.
Biological function summary
MMP16 is essential in facilitating cellular activities such as migration invasion and angiogenesis. This protein operates as part of a complex that activates other MMPs including pro-MMP2 boosting their enzymatic activity. MMP16 participates in cellular remodeling by regulating the interactions between cells and their matrix which influences cell signaling and tissue morphogenesis.
Pathways
MMP16 integrates into pathways relevant to extracellular matrix remodeling and cell signaling. It is actively involved in the Wnt and MAPK signaling pathways which influence various biological processes including development and cell proliferation. MMP16 also shows interactions with other MMP family members like MMP2 and MMP14 which collectively modulate the local microenvironment and cellular dynamics.
MMP16 is associated with cancer progression and neurodegenerative diseases. In cancer its upregulation correlates with tumor invasion and metastasis owing to its role in degradation of the basement membrane. MMP16 also contributes to neurodegenerative conditions like Alzheimer's Disease by affecting synaptic functions and neuron survival. It interacts with proteins like APP involved in Alzheimer's linking MMP16 to amyloid beta peptide processing and aggregation.
